Output 152fd7f69a79609b726f6f5e625250af048a3bfdaba411dad2817a078ec21cca:0

value
996429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561c2048c3e60c1ac20457449db05c9424b24974 OP_EQUAL
address
39YKjH41j1b2KofJNsZHiB7DyMqD7Ea2rU
transaction
152fd7f69a79609b726f6f5e625250af048a3bfdaba411dad2817a078ec21cca
confirmations
366153
spent
true